Orlen
Pronounced OR-luhn /หษr.lษn/Medium
Meaning: Orlen is most plausibly a trimmed form of Orlando - the Italian form of Roland, from the Germanic hrod ('fame') and land ('land'), 'famous land.' As a rare American given name it may also be a coinage on the '-len' pattern; the route is uncertain.Low

History & Origin
Orlen is best read as a short form of Orlando (Italian for Roland, 'famous land'), though it may be an independent American coinage. Rare in every decade, it has the trim, modern sound of early-century '-len' names.
It was never common, given to only about fifteen boys a year even at its peak around 1934. A boy named Orlen then would belong to his great-grandfather's generation.
